- The distance between Port Arthur, Tx, Usa and Tokushima, Japan is approximately 11,259 km or 6,996 mi.
- To reach Port Arthur, Tx in this distance one would set out from Tokushima bearing 41.5°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Port Arthur, Tx bearing 140.7° or SE .
- Both have a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- The mean temperature is 4.3 °C (7.7°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 4.1 °C (7.4°F) less in Port Arthur, Tx.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 161.9 mm (6.4 in) less which is equivalent to 161.9 l/m² (3.97 US gal/ft²) or 1,619,000 l/ha (173,082 US gal/ac) less. About 8/9 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 4.1° higher in Port Arthur, Tx than in Tokushima.
